DataScope Acquires Safety for Life to Advance Workplace Safety
The acquisition enhances digital risk management and supports compliance with Supreme Decree No. 44.

Chilean startup DataScope has announced the acquisition of Safety for Life, a company specializing in digital solutions for occupational risk management. This strategic move reinforces DataScope’s commitment to workplace safety by integrating Safety for Life’s extensive industry expertise with its own cutting-edge technology. The merger is expected to enhance digital preventive measures and support companies in complying with Chile’s newly implemented Supreme Decree No. 44.

Proven Results and Future Expectations
DataScope’s platform has already demonstrated its ability to drive operational efficiency, with clients reporting up to a 47% reduction in time spent on administrative tasks. These efficiency gains translate into an overall productivity increase of up to 28%, benefiting entire teams. About DataScope
DataScope is a leading provider of digital solutions designed to streamline industrial processes and enhance workplace safety. Its web platform and mobile app help businesses transition from paper-based workflows to real-time digital data collection, saving time and costs. With over two million users across 17 countries, DataScope continues to innovate in occupational safety, inspections, maintenance, and quality control.
